#c43107 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c43107 is composed of 76.9% red, 19.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 13.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#c43107 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ff620e with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c43107 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c43107 has RGB values of R:196, G:49,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.96,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12857607.

Shades and Tints of #c43107
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070200 is the darkest color, while #fff5f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c43107
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666565 is the less saturated color, while #c43107 is the most saturated one.
